If you belong to AAA, and the medication is one that a regular
pharmacy carries you can get some good deals. For us Jewel's Prozac
is regularly $15.something/month, with a AAA card it is $5.46.
Seamus's Flovent inhaler only went from the $90s to the $80s but it
was something. You can check on the website to see what the cost
would be.

How many MLs for $31? I got Clavamox for Scarlett after her surgery
to drain a nasty infection for $15.63 for 15 mls, and I think that
was even overpriced.

When Shadow needed maintenance prednisone and metronidazole for IBD,
I bought in bulk online because our vet said she couldn't beat their
prices. petcarerx.com I think it was. He died soon after a refill of
100 5mg prednisone and 200 metronidazole (can't remember the
strength) and I just gave it to the vets office so they could give it
to financially challenged clients. I hope it went to good use.
